What is an ethical software engineer?

An Ethical Software Engineer is a professional who develops software with a strong focus on ethical considerations, such as privacy, security, fairness, and minimizing harm. They ensure that the software they create aligns with ethical standards, legal requirements, and societal values. Their role often involves evaluating the potential impacts of technology on users and communities and advocating for responsible design and implementation practices. Ethical software engineers work to prevent bias, protect user data, and promote transparency in software systems.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an ethical software engineer?

To thrive as an Ethical Software Engineer, you need strong programming abilities, knowledge of software development processes, and a solid understanding of ethical frameworks in technology, often supported by a degree in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with secure coding practices, privacy compliance tools, and certifications like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) or relevant cybersecurity credentials is valuable. Critical thinking, integrity, and effective communication help you navigate complex ethical dilemmas and collaborate across diverse teams. These skills ensure the creation of responsible, secure, and trustworthy software that aligns with both user needs and societal values.

How does an ethical software engineer typ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ure responsible technology development?

Ethical Software Engineers often work closely with product managers, designers, and data scientists to identify potential ethical risks early in the development process. They participate in regular meetings to review project goals, propose safeguards, and ensure that ethical considerations are embedded in both design and implementation. This collaborative approach helps create transparent, fair, and accountable technology solutions while fostering a culture of shared responsibility across the organization.

Strata-G is seeking experienced Mechanical Engineers with the following:

Job Summary

We are seeking skilled and detail-oriented Mechanical Engineers to manage the full lifecycle of our mechanical products. In this role, you will collaborate with cross-functional teams to translate concept designs into reliable, manufacturable, and functional hardware systems.

Core Responsibilities

  • Design & Modeling: Create detailed 3D models and 2D technical drawings using CAD software like SolidWorks or AutoCAD.
  • Analysis & Simulation: Perform engineering calculations, stress tests, thermal analyses, and fluid dynamics simulations.
  • Prototyping & Testing: Build and test physical prototypes to evaluate performance, troubleshoot flaws, and validate designs.
  • Production Support: Oversee the manufacturing process, coordinate with vendors, and ensure designs are optimized for fabrication.
  • Documentation: Write technical manuals, prepare design reports, and maintain accurate bills of materials (BOM).

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related technical discipline.
  • Years of experience: 3-5 yrs experience.
  • Software: Proficiency in computer-aided design (CAD) and computer-aided engineering (CAE) tools.
  • Technical Knowledge: Strong foundational grasp of mechanics, thermodynamics, fluid dynamics, and materials science.
  • Problem Solving: Advanced analytical skills to diagnose machinery failures and implement root-cause fixes.
  • Collaboration: Excellent communication skills to work alongside electrical engineers, project managers, and suppliers.
